Okay, that looks more like a remote for a DTV Pal. The original model remotes for that digital-to-analog OTA converter box also controlled Dish satellite receivers at the same time (which was a problem if someone had both) so Dish came out with this model, that does not work for Dish receivers at all.

No it's not the pal remote, I have a few pal remotes also, they look identical, the pal remote has a analog pass through button
You're right. I just checked my Pal remote (1.5 NDB 163692) and in addition to the TV/Video button being labeled Analog Pass-Through, the Page Up / Down buttons are labeled as Picture Format and CC. The remote in your picture also has an older version of the Dish Network logo than my Pal remote.

No it's not the pal remote, I have a few pal remotes also, they look identical, the pal remote has a analog pass through button, I am starting to wonder if these are UHF remotes

They're IR, they were used with the 111, 1000, 2700 and 2800 receivers. I guess they removed the support for these remotes in later receivers like your 211.
